Neymar’s company suspends its contract with a pharmaceutical company targeted by police forces

NR Sports, the company that manages Neymar Jr.’s career, has suspended its partnership contract with Unikka Pharma, after the company was the target of a Federal Police (PF) operation against a network dedicated to the illegal production, retail and sale of Mounjaro, an injectable drug for the treatment of diabetes and obesity, last Thursday (27/11).

NR Sports said in a statement that the contract was suspended by mutual agreement, allowing Unikka to present its version and defense regarding the accusations.

The statement issued by Neymar’s family company concluded: “After the investigation and completion of the investigations, we will analyze the final solution to the contract.”

On social media, Unikka Pharma stated that it was the target of injustice and denied being part of an illegal scheme to sell and manipulate the Monjaro product.

The company stressed on its website that it is a legal pharmacy with more than 300 employees. Moreover, he said that he operates with all licenses from the National Health Surveillance Agency (Anvisa) and the Coordination of Health Surveillance of the São Paulo Municipal Health Secretariat (Covisa) and sells medicines only with prescriptions.

The pharmaceutical company attributed the federal police investigation to the fact that “a foreign multinational company was not able to compete.” Later, in a second statement, Unica stated that doctor Gabriel Almeida, who was also investigated in the police operation, had no institutional connection to the company and was only occasionally hired, through an educational company, to give lectures and scientific events.

Operation Mongaro

Federal Police (PF) agents found luxury cars and watches, as well as a jet plane, while executing 24 search and seizure warrants at clinics, laboratories, commercial establishments and residences linked to those investigated in the states of São Paulo, Rio de Janeiro, Bahia and Pernambuco.

The investigation revealed that the group maintained a manufacturing structure in conditions inconsistent with health standards, and carried out irregular packaging, labeling and distribution of the product. Evidence of mass production on an industrial scale has been found, a practice not permitted by law.

The investigation also revealed the sale of items through digital platforms, “without minimum quality controls, sterility or traceability, which increases health risks to the consumer,” according to PF. Furthermore, digital marketing strategies induced the public to believe that routine production of tirzepatide, the drug’s active ingredient, would be permissible.

The institution stated that “the measures taken aim to stop the illegal activity, identify those responsible for the production and distribution chain, and collect documents, equipment and inputs that assist in laboratory analysis and technical expertise of the seized materials.”

Last week’s operation was supported by the National Health Surveillance Agency (Anvisa) and the health surveillance of the states of São Paulo, Bahia and Pernambuco.
